Installing the Husqvarna 599332501 kit takes about 15-30 minutes with basic tools like pliers and a screwdriver. Always work in a well-ventilated area and disconnect the spark plug wire first for safety.
- Replace the air filter: Remove the cover, swap the old filter, and reinstall securely to maintain clean airflow.
- Install the fuel filter: Drain old fuel if needed, pull the old filter from the tank line, and insert the new one.
- Gap and seat the spark plug: Check the gap to spec (usually 0.02-0.03 inches), thread in hand-tight plus a quarter turn.
Test run your blower after reassembly to confirm smooth operation. Regular checks prevent bigger issues down the line.
Keep your 125B or 125BVX blower in top shape with a seasonal tune-up routine using this kit. Check filters after every 10 hours of use or monthly during heavy seasons.
- Inspect air filter for dirt buildup that chokes power.
- Examine fuel filter for clogs from stale gas.
- Replace spark plug annually or at 100 hours for reliable ignition.
Store dry and clean, using fuel stabilizer for winter. This prevents starting problems come spring yard work.
Time your maintenance to avoid breakdowns during busy gardening periods. Signs it's needed include hard starts, weak blowing, or excessive smoke.
- Every 25 hours or monthly for frequent users clearing large lawns.
- Before storage to protect against fuel gumming.
- Post-winter startup for optimal performance.

Swapping parts is straightforward and tool-free for most steps. Start by disconnecting the spark plug wire and draining fuel safely.
- Air filter: Unclip the cover, remove old filter, snap in the new 4-3/8" x 3-3/8" x 1-3/4" unit, and resecure.
- Fuel filter: Pinch and pull the old one from the tank line, insert the replacement firmly.
- Spark plug: Use a socket wrench to remove the old, gap the new to spec (around 0.02"), and torque lightly.
Clean surrounding areas first to avoid dirt entry. Test-run after install to confirm smooth operation.
Keep your Stihl BR800 series blower reliable with routine checks tailored to yard use intensity.
- Every 25 hours or monthly: Inspect and clean air filter; replace if clogged.
- Every 50 hours or seasonally: Swap fuel filter to prevent carburetor issues.
- Every 100 hours or annually: Change spark plug for consistent starts.
For heavy leaf blowing in fall, accelerate the schedule. Always use fresh fuel-oil mix and store dry over winter.

Know the signs to replace leaf blower parts for optimal yard performance.
- Air filter: Dirty, clogged, or torn; reduced power or overheating.
- Spark plug: Hard starts, misfires, or black soot buildup.
- Fuel filter: Engine stalling, fuel leaks, or poor idling.
Proactive swaps prevent breakdowns during peak leaf season, saving time on garden maintenance.

Replacing parts in your Stihl BR800 blower is straightforward with basic tools like a screwdriver and gloves. Always work in a well-ventilated area and let the engine cool.
- Air Filter: Remove the cover, swap the old filter for the new 4283-141-0300A, and reinstall securely.
- Fuel Filter: Drain fuel, pull out the old 0000 350 3518 filter with needle-nose pliers, insert the new one into the tank line.
- Spark Plug: Gap the 0000 400 7011 plug to specs, remove old with socket wrench, torque new to 15-20 ft-lbs.
Test run the blower after each step to ensure smooth operation. Regular tune-ups extend engine life for years of reliable yard work.
